118: Recurring Giving Trends: Unlocking Sustainable Revenue for Nonprofits with Abby Jarvis

Season 1 Episode 118 Published 1 year, 10 months ago
Description

Abby Jarvis, Head of Content at Neon One, is sharing the latest data on recurring giving—a sector that has seen significant growth over the past five years. What makes Abby's insights invaluable is her ability to break down complex data into actionable steps that won’t overwhelm you. Find out proven strategies for promoting and sustaining recurring donations, including personalized communication approaches and leveraging key opportunities like Giving Tuesday. 

Topics:

  • Growth in recurring giving: Industry-wide, there was a 3.5% decrease in active supporters, but a 127% increase in monthly donors.
  • Retention and lifetime value of recurring donors: Ending the hamster wheel of giving to create something that is more sustainable and scalable 
  • Organic growth and engagement: 50% of recurring donors in the study made additional gifts, including volunteering, serving on boards, and purchasing memberships
  • Beyond consumer choices: How to use the emotional decisions of giving to your benefit and other strategies to encourage recurring giving
  • Year-end fundraising and recurring giving: 12% of all recurring donations are initiated on Giving Tuesday, plus how to highlight the impact of their gifts and the urgency of your cause
